Performance meets luxury with the all-new Audi S8 

2021 has been a very busy year for Audi, the RS family has been overly extended, and now the S8 has officially landed in South Africa. Combing luxury and power, the S8 promises to be one of the most exhilarating sedans to ever brace the Audi market. The S8’s all-powerful V8 engine will be combined with mild-hybrid technology. It will produce a power output of 420kW and 800 Nm of torque. Audi has claimed that the S8 can rocket from 0-100 in just 3.8 seconds and can reach a top speed of 250 km/h. The benefits of the mild hybrid system (MHEV) being installed is that it will continuously work to reduce the fuel consumption. The 48-volt belt alternator starter and the additional lithium-ion battery will allow the vehicle to be cruising even when the engine is switched off. Audi claims that fuel savings will be up to 0.8 litres per 100 kilometres. The S8’s sound system will also feature active noise cancellation to eliminate any unwanted cabin noise, ensuring that both the driver and passengers have maximum comfort.  

The S8 will also come standard with a predictive active suspension. This high-tech system will work in combination with the air suspension, it will be able to either lift or push down each wheel separately through the electromechanical actuators. This will then make it possible for one to actively control the trim of the body in any driving situation, therefore reducing pitch or roll during acceleration or braking. As expected, the S8 will feature the Audi drive select system that offers five profiles to choose from. A new profile called “Comfort +” mode has also been made too and promises to even help things like cornering become a comfortable experience. The S8 will further redefine what can be physically possible for a vehicle and that is thanks to its dynamic-all-wheel steering. This will allow independent adjustment to both the steering angles at the front and rear axles.  

Like all Audi’s, the S8 will exude class and elegance throughout its bold exterior design. Its outside will feature new accents that have never been seen before. Detailing on the front bumper, side sills, and exterior mirror housing will emphasize the S8’s sporty design. The upper inlay, which is available exclusively to the S8 will be made from Carbon Vector, this will further impress its special 3D depth effect. Lighting options on the S8 will range from its standard HD Matrix LED headlights with dynamic turn signals to Audi’s laser light and OLED rear lights as an optional extra. The rear too looks just as mean with its two S-typical twin oval exhaust tailpipes capturing its dominant character. The black styling package will be available as an option too. With this, all chrome elements right down to the tailpipe trims will come in high-gloss black. An optional extended black styling package will be made optional too, this sees the Audi rings and nameplate appear in glossy black as well. 

Inside, the S8 will come equipped with individually contoured comfort sports seats. The upholstery will come available in fine Valcona leather. The rear seats too will offer numerous comfort features, providing passengers a first-class experience with the Audi S8. An intelligent park assist 360° camera, and heads-up display are just among the few standard safety equipment found in the S8. As expected, the S8 will come with state-of-the-art connectivity. The highly advanced MMI touch response operating concept has now become fully digital. Nearly all the driver controls will function through its two large displays. All driving-relevant displays will appear in the standard Audi virtual cockpit plus, and be switched between two views. The S8’s cabin will also come equipped MMI navigation plus which will serve as the infotainment and media centre.   

The latest Audi S8 is currently available across South Africa and will be sold with a five-year Audi Freeway Plan. 

Pricing (inclusive of all taxes)  

Audi S8 TFSI quattro                 R2 484 000
